Born in 1968 in Kwa-Thema, Thembekile Skonde dedicated her life to education, faith, and service, shaping countless lives along the way.
Early Life and Education
Growing up in Kwa-Thema, Thembekile Skonde showed early signs of leadership and a strong commitment to learning. She attended Kwa-Thema Combined School before continuing to Nkumbulo Secondary School. Her passion for teaching led her to obtain a Teacher’s Diploma from Daveyton Teachers’ College. She further enriched her expertise through studies at Rand University and the University of the Witwatersrand (Wits), building a solid foundation for her professional journey.

Distinguished Career in Education
Thembekile Skonde began her teaching career in 1992 at Groblersdal Primary School. Her dedication quickly became evident, and she went on to teach at Sithembiso Primary and Geluksdal Primary School. Over the years, she moved through various roles, including Head of Department and Deputy Principal, showcasing her leadership skills and unwavering commitment to education.
Becoming a Principal
In 2019, Thembekile was appointed Principal of Emzimkhulu Primary School in Duduza. Her innovative approach and ability to motivate both students and staff transformed the school environment. By January 2025, her reputation for excellence earned her the role of Administrator Principal at Duduza Primary School, highlighting her as one of the most influential educational leaders in the region.
Community Leadership and Pastoral Work
Beyond her achievements in education, Thembekile Skonde served as Senior Pastor at Rhema Sycomore Tree Ministries in Reedville. Her dual commitment to education and spiritual guidance allowed her to influence the community profoundly. She actively supported Women Power Through Christ (WPC) and served on the executive committee of the Wright Park CPF, demonstrating her dedication to societal development.

Family and Personal Life
Thembekile Skonde is survived by her loving husband, her son, three grandchildren, three sisters, two brothers, and her mother. Her strong family ties reflected her values of love, respect, and commitment, which she seamlessly integrated into her professional and community endeavors.

Farewell and Funeral Service
Thembekile Skonde’s funeral service will be held on Saturday, from 09:00 to 12:30, at Rhema Jehovah Jireh Ministry, Wright Park, Springs.
